Appellant<\/strong><\/div>\n<div style=\"text-align: left;\">Versus<\/div>\n<div style=\"color: #444444;\"><strong>Rajeev Kaul \u2026\u2026..Respondent<br \/><\/strong><\/div>\n<div style=\"color: #444444;\">ORDER<\/div>\n<div style=\"color: #444444;\">Leave granted.<\/div>\n<div style=\"color: #444444;\">2) In the appeal filed by the  respondent-husband before the High Court of Punjab and Haryana, being  aggrieved by the judgment and decree passed by Addl. District Judge  (Ad-hoc), Fast Track Court No.3, Faridabad, dated 04.06.2005, the  appellant herein had filed an application under Section 24 of Hindu  Marriage Act, 1955, for the grant of interim maintenance of Rs. 10,000\/-  (Rupees Ten Thousand only) and the litigation expense of Rs. 22,000\/-  (Rupees Twenty Two Thousand only).<\/div>\n<div style=\"color: #444444;\"><strong>The application is partly allowed by the Court by its order dated 23.08.2006, by granting an amount of <span>Rs.10,000<\/span>\/-  towards litigation expense and a sum of Rs.2,000\/- for the maintenance  of the minor child living with her. The Review Petition is also  dismissed by the Court vide its order dated 21.03.2007, leaving it open  to the appellant\/applicant to claim interim maintenance before an  appropriate forum in the capacity as a Guardian of the child.<\/strong><\/div>\n<div style=\"color: #444444;\">3) Challenging both the orders, the appellant-wife is before us in these appeals.<\/div>\n<div style=\"color: #444444;\">4) Though notice of special leave petition is  served on the respondent- husband, for the reason best known to him, has  not entered appearance either in person or through his counsel.<\/div>\n<div style=\"color: #444444;\">5) Marriage between the parties and birth of  the female child Karmistha Kaul is not in dispute. The assertion of the  appellant in the application filed under Section 24 of Hindu Marriage  Act, 1955 that the respondent is working as a Senior Head of Mukund  Steel Ltd., having its head office at Mumbai and drawing a salary of <span>Rs.40,000<\/span>\/-  per month and is entitled to claim perks for the education of his  children was not denied by the respondent by filing his counter  affidavit or reply statement.<\/div>\n<div style=\"color: #444444;\">6) In the application filed, the appellant  admits that she is employed and drawing a salary of Rs.9,000\/- per  month. However, she asserts, she has to pay an amount of Rs.3,000\/- by  way of rent to the tenanted premises which she is presently occupying in  view of the lis between the parties. She has also stated, that, Kumari  Karmisatha Kaul is now grown up and she is studying in Senior School and  due to insufficient funds, her education is being hampered.<\/div>\n<div style=\"color: #444444;\">7) A sermon on moral responsibility and  ethics, in our opinion for disposing of this appeal may not be  necessary, since the respondent has not disputed the assertion of the  appellant.<em><strong>However, since the appellant is employed and is  drawing a salary of Rs.9,000\/- per month, we do not intend to enhance  the interim maintenance awarded to her by the High Court during the  pendency of the appeal filed by the husband.&nbsp;<\/strong><\/em>However,  taking into consideration the child being the daughter of highly placed  officer, the exorbitant fee structure in good Schools and the cost of  living, we deem it proper to direct the respondent to pay a sum of  Rs.5,000\/- per month to the applicant commencing from 1st of April, 2009  for the maintenance of the minor child during the pendency of the  appeals before the High Court. 8) The appeals are disposed of  accordingly.<\/div>\n<div style=\"color: #444444;\">\u2026\u2026\u2026\u2026\u2026\u2026\u2026\u2026\u2026\u2026\u2026\u2026\u2026J.
